CSM is also known as Legacy Mode, Legacy BIOS, BIOS Mode. Also nomodeset. Press Tab on that second screen in your pic you dumbfuck. And then follow whatever result you find in google. If you cant even manage this i dont know how you'll keep up in the partitioning page.
Alexander Carter
Looks like it's cranking your brightness up at that point of the boot which sometimes can be flipped on Linux depending on your hardware i.e. 100% will be 0%
When you get to the point that the screen is blank try pressing the Brightness - key on your keyboard.
